UCI prohibits 650c fronts. All of the races you would compete in (unless you're seeding for national team or international competitions) are governed by USAC, not UCI. All national team qualifying and international qualifying races, must meet UCI requirements and as of Jan 1st, all NRC races have to meet UCI too.
I doubt any of the above conditions apply to you. You'll probably be okay for an open training, but I would ask before showing up to a race with one. |
